    Gitonga’s Stunning ⁤Debut:‍ A New Star in Mountain Running

    In an impressive‍ demonstration of resilience and skill,Gitonga claimed victory at the Longonot Trail Challenge,marking a breathtaking entry into the realm of mountain running.⁢ Entering the competition with little planning, his remarkable performance on Mount Longonot’s demanding terrain left both spectators and fellow⁣ athletes in ‍awe. This​ unexpected win‍ not only showcases‌ Gitonga’s ⁢innate talent ​but also prompts discussions⁣ about the untapped⁣ potential of emerging athletes​ within this sport. As excitement builds following this event, enthusiasts‌ are ⁤keen to see what lies ahead for this ⁤promising‌ newcomer.

    Gitonga’s Remarkable Victory at ​Longonot Trail‍ Challenge

    In a ⁢thrilling twist during the race, Gitonga displayed exceptional talent and resolve at the Longonot Trail Challenge despite his lack of extensive​ training. Competing in his inaugural mountain‌ running ⁤event, he ⁤surpassed expectations by finishing​ ahead of more experienced runners. Set​ against ​the‍ breathtaking backdrop of Mount Longonot, participants faced⁤ tough challenges due to its ​rugged terrain and ⁣elevation; however, Gitonga’s natural athletic ability proved pivotal.

    With encouragement from‌ fellow competitors and ‍local supporters alike, Gitonga focused on⁣ sustaining a consistent pace while skillfully⁤ maneuvering through obstacles.⁤ Key highlights from his performance included:

    • Amazing Speed: His sprint​ times astonished many observers.
    • Tactical Course⁢ Navigation: His adaptability to challenging​ paths kept⁤ him leading throughout.
    • Civic Support: The backing from locals substantially uplifted his spirits during the race.

    This victory is not merely personal for Gitonga; it symbolizes hope for emerging athletes⁢ in Kenya’s trail running scene. With conversations ignited about mountain running’s future in ⁣Kenya due to ‍his success, many​ are eager to witness how he prepares for upcoming events. Clearly, ‍gitonga’s triumph at ‌the⁤ Longonot Trail‌ Challenge marks just the begining of‌ what could ⁤be an extraordinary athletic journey.
